WILMINGTON -- The 21st annual Whiteface Oktoberfest will be held Saturday Sept. 29 from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m. and Sunday, Sept. 30 from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.
The event will include original vendors, arts and crafts, children’s amusement rides such as a hayride and inflatables, Bavarian food, drink and entertainment.
There will be traditional German music from Die Schlauberger, who will perform under the entertainment tent outside the base lodge each day, Ed Schenk on the accordion, Schachtelgebirger Musikanten (Scha-Musi) at the Cloudspin Lounge, and Spitze and The Alpen Trio.
Spitze features cowbells, the alpine xylophone, the alphorn and yodeling, while the Alpen Trio will greet Cloudsplitter Gondola passengers at the summit of Little Whiteface with the alphorns.
The dancing groups Alpenland Taenzer and “Kindergruppe” will also perform. Kindergruppe is comprised of couples ages 3-19.
Admission is $15 for adults, $9 for juniors and seniors, and gondola rides are $13. For more information about Oktoberfest, including complimentary shuttle times and a full event schedule, log on to http://www.whiteface.com/summer/events/octoberfest.php.
